    18:42 This is “Foi Thong” (ฝอยทอง). It is originated from “fios de ovos”, traditional Portuguese sweet food. Portuguese chef introduced it 300 years ago in Ayutthaya period.

    Actually the butter bread you have to have the staff grill it for you. Then the butter on the bread will melt and mix with the bread. And the staff will have a sauce for you to choose from. condensed milk, chocolate and strawberries 😁😁😁

    I am Thai, 7-11 is just in front of my housing village. Every morning I buy packed street food from Thai vendors who sell in front of 7-11 on public pavement as my first priority. The cost is about 35 baht such as Pad Kapao Pork with Egg. 7-11 sells Pad Kapao Pork with no egg for 40 baht. On Sunday, no street vendor so I have to buy 40 baht microwaved meal from 7-11. I also buy 2 yoghurt cups every morning at 7-11. It is good for digestion and gut health. When I drive to travel in provinces, always stops at PTT petrol station to relieve myself and buy something to eat/drink at 7-11. I think practically all Thai drivers do the same.

    Note: Alcohol sale is banned on religious holidays and evening prior to general election day and election day itself. On regular day, alcohol sale is available from 11.00-14.00 and 17.00-24.00 at 7-11 and mini/super stores, Lotus or Big C. However, this is Thailand and you can always buy your favorite beer/liquor at your small convenient store in your village at all hours (if the store opens). Some shops stay open until 2 am on Friday and Saturday in some villages. Don't know why the police ignore those small shops selling alcohol at all hours.
